Output d308f18bb7d594fee145ddc75006b34d1e91fbc45fcac10e3bb262acab128240:2

value
119006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ab711be81e0737c1d7867513e5a645811ebf40a OP_EQUAL
address
3P65MJzGjoKZi9unQFLWrLdjrn9VVu1Q2v
transaction
d308f18bb7d594fee145ddc75006b34d1e91fbc45fcac10e3bb262acab128240
confirmations
128446
spent
true